“Small acts, when multiplied by millions of people, can transform the world……”

Engaging in community service provides students with the opportunity to become active members of their community and has a lasting, positive impact on society at large. Community service or volunteerism enables students to acquire life skills and knowledge, as well as provide a service to those who need it the most.

Keeping the same in mind, the students of class III A were taken to an old age home- ‘Kamla Bakshi Vanaprastha Ashram’ situated in Rohini on April 25, 2018. The students had prepared different presentations on tourism, food, dresses, monuments, famous personalities and dance of Jammu and Kashmir. The students in one of the groups dressed up like Kashmiri people to demonstrate its culture to the senior citizens and another group presented a dance on a very famous song ‘Bhoomro Bhoomro.’

The group representing Kashmiri cuisine brought ‘Dum Aloo’ and ‘Modur Pulav’ for the elderly people. They enjoyed interacting and singing rhymes for the elders in chorus. It was a great learning experience for the little kids.
